Output 818516b036eb5982343b93168283bccc1f41f9bb0aa003837d0abd7fdfb8f963:0

value
718957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c97bf408d11d517ab2384e46318484b80e397ad OP_EQUALVERIFY OP_CHECKSIG
address
154nX1ikBw91ovFHpuFA6mdKxbKbj41WFx
transaction
818516b036eb5982343b93168283bccc1f41f9bb0aa003837d0abd7fdfb8f963
confirmations
122986
spent
true